Analysis
The most recent figure for food household consumption — emissions in Kyrgyzstan is 0.0302 kt, measured in 2023.
The figure is down 6.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, food household consumption — emissions in Kyrgyzstan peaked at 0.1548 kt in 2017 and was at its lowest, 0.0014 kt, in 1997.
Kyrgyzstan ranks 92nd of 202 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
